I was fortunate to acquire a can of this product in a trade and it turned out to be one of the best new beers I've tried in recent months. Although it's probably destined to be a seasonal product, I believe it's of sufficient body and taste to be a part of Foundations regular lineup. I may be disappointed as to its availability but I'll certainly try to pick up a 4-pk on my next trip to Maine.

A: Pours a hazy yellow color with 2 fingers of head that quickly fades down to an almost non-existent cap
S: Lots of banana and clove up front along with a yeasty undertone. Wheat in there as well
T: Follows the nose. Starts off with the banana and clove notes followed by yeasty and wheat undertones. A little on the husky side
M: Medium bodied with moderate carbonation
O: A solid hefe packed with banana and clove. Super easy to drink. Great for the summer time

Pint on draft at Hella Good. RIP Hella Good!!
Appearance: Cloudy straw with a soapy head that disappears swiftly. After that, very flat.
Aroma: Honey, wheat. Mostly light on the nose.
Taste: Wheat, grass, honey, little bit of lemon. More lemony as it warms.
Mouthfeel: Pretty light of body.
Overall: I think this is the butt end of the keg. That said, it’s a pretty mediocre weizen. This brewery generally does better work than this.
